Testing Times

Loading...

Flash Player 9 (or above) is needed to view presentations.
We have detected that you do not have it on your computer. To install it, go here.

0 comments

Post a comment

    Post a comment
    Embed Video
    Edit your comment Cancel

    Favorites, Groups & Events

    Testing Times - Presentation Transcript

    1. Testing Times Drive your Development and Trust your Code.
    2. Rule #1 Test Your Code • Unit Tests - you have them, right? • Why? Confidence & Contract • Multi-developer Friendly • Backward Compatibility / API Compliance • Accountability (halt scope creep!)
    3. Standard Iterations 1. Specification 2. Implementation to Spec 3. Testing 4. Release
    4. TDD Iterations 1. Specification 2. Testing 3. Implementation to Tests 4. Release
    5. Rule #2 Run Your Tests • 3 types of tests • Unit / Integration / Acceptance • Unit tests should be very fast run every build • Integration tests should be run before commit (You use version control, right?) • Acceptance tests are hard to automate
    6. Cruise Control
    7. Bamboo
    8. Rule #3 Get Covered • Measure Code Coverage • Tests (EMMA, Cobertura, Clover) • Peer Review (Crucible) • Identify & Repair Unacceptable Risk
    9. Crucible
    10. TDD Example or Discussion?

    + dhardikerdhardiker, 2 years ago

    custom

    450 views, 0 favs, 2 embeds more stats

    A talk given at BarCamp Manchester on 2nd March 200 more

    More Info

    © All Rights Reserved

    Go to text version
    • Total Views 450
      • 442 on SlideShare
      • 8 from embeds
    • Comments 0
    • Favorites 0
    • Downloads 5
    Most viewed embeds
    • 6 views on http://www.adaptavist.com
    • 2 views on https://www.adaptavist.com

    more

    All embeds
    • 6 views on http://www.adaptavist.com
    • 2 views on https://www.adaptavist.com

    less

    Flagged as inappropriate Flag as inappropriate
    Flag as innappropriate

    Select your reason for flagging this presentation as inappropriate. If needed, use the feedback form to let us know more details.

    Cancel

    Categories